Transitioning pieces are those items in our wardrobe that help us look fabulous and stay current with the weather changes. We are currently (but very slowly) experiencing warmer weather. This is the perfect time to wear those spring dresses, jumpsuits, and tanks and simply layer them. Although it's too cold to wear spaghetti straps out alone, try pairing it with an oversized denim jacket or lightweight blazer. This look features a spaghetti strap jumpsuit from Zara, utility jacket from Love Culture, and a cute snakeskin bootie I got from Nasty Gal. I also played around with accesorize. One of my favorite things to do with baggy items is to throw on a chain belt. Instantly so chic!
